   Questions To Ask before Hiring Your Contractor

   Are you a class "A" state registered contractor?
   There are three classes of state-registered contractors,
   Class "A", Class "B", and Class "C". The licensing
   requirements to achieve a Class "A" are the most
   difficult to meet. Brown Building & Remodeling, Inc. is
   a Class "A" state registered contractor.

  Will you furnish me with a list of your past customers?

   Do not ask for one or two references. Most contractors could furnish that. Ask for 10 or more
   names and telephone numbers, then call three or four. We furnish every potential customer
   with a list of references in the "introductory Package" we mail to each customer who calls
   us for information.

    Will you furnish me with detailed specifications written in easily understandable
   language?

   More problems and misunderstandings develop in this area than anywhere else. Be sure you
   clearly understand what the contractor is doing and what he is not doing. We review our specs
   in thorough detail with each customer before contracting.

   What insurance do you carry to protect me in case an accident occurs?

   If your contractor is not properly insured and if someone gets hurt on the job and it can happen,
   you may have to pay for the expense and loss of income resulting from the worker being
   injured.  Request a copy of your contractor's insurance policy and make sure his coverages
   are adequate. We are heavily insured and will review this with you.
